.auth-container.svelte-8bdjn9{max-width:400px;margin:4rem auto;padding:2rem;text-align:center}.error.svelte-8bdjn9{color:var(--danger);font-size:.9rem}button.svelte-8bdjn9{padding:.75rem 1.5rem;font-size:1rem;cursor:pointer;border:1px solid var(--border);border-radius:6px;background:var(--surface);color:var(--text)}button.svelte-8bdjn9:disabled{opacity:.6;cursor:not-allowed}a.svelte-8bdjn9{color:var(--text-dim);font-size:.85rem}.recovery-codes.svelte-8bdjn9{text-align:left}.recovery-codes.svelte-8bdjn9 ol:where(.svelte-8bdjn9){margin:1rem 0;padding-left:1.5rem}.recovery-codes.svelte-8bdjn9 li:where(.svelte-8bdjn9){margin:.4rem 0}.recovery-codes.svelte-8bdjn9 code:where(.svelte-8bdjn9){font-family:monospace;font-size:1rem}.recovery-codes.svelte-8bdjn9 a:where(.svelte-8bdjn9){display:block;margin-top:1rem;font-size:.95rem}
